wuts up guys, i was driving the other day cruising perfectly fine until i noticed smoke coming from my gear shift inside my car, i pulled over and i must have been losing tranny fluid atleast a quart a second..... not i've come to the conclusion that my rear tranny seal is busted because the fluid is running out from that area, i understand i have to drop the exhaust and take out the driveshaft but me and tranny's dont get along to well.....has anyone ever done the seal??? is it simple??....should i replace the seal or the whole sleave??....

easy job. drop exhaust. disconnect driveshaft in the rear. pull it out and change the seal. dont forget to drain whats left of the fluid and add new. check around while the cars apart to make sure thats where its leaking from. i have seen a couple n/a tranny cases crack.
